Keto No-Bake Cheesecake Delight

Indulge in creamy, tangy, guilt-free bliss made with wholesome ingredients, perfect for any occasion!
Prep Time 15 minutes
Chilling Time 4 hours
Total Time 4 hours 15 minutes
Servings 12 slices
Calories 265 kcal

Equipment

  • Springform Pan

Ingredients
  

Crust Ingredients

  • 1.5 cups Almond Flour (toasted for extra flavor, if you like!)
  • 3 Tablespoons Powdered Erythritol (or your preferred keto sweetener for the crust)
  • 4 Tablespoons Butter (melted)
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la Extract (optional, but lovely in the crust)
  • 1 Pinch Sea Salt (to perfectly balance the flavors)

Filling Ingredients

  • 16 ounces Full-Fat Cream Cheese (softened to perfection)
  • 1 cup Cold Heavy Whipping Cream
  • 0.5 cup Powdered Erythritol (or a stevia blend for the filling)
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la Extract (adds a beautiful aroma to the filling)
  • 1 Tablespoon Fresh Lemon Juice (for that delightful tang!)
  • 1 teaspoon Unflavored Gelatin (optional, for an extra firm slice)

Instructions
 

  • First, combine your almond flour, erythritol, melted butter, optional vanilla, and a pinch of salt in a bowl. Mix until it resembles a delightful damp sand texture.
  • Gently press this delicious mixture evenly into the bottom of your chosen pan. Pop it into the fridge to chill while you prepare the creamy filling.
  • In a separate b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until it's wonderfully light and fluffy.
  • Now, blend in the powdered erythritol, vanilla extract, and fresh lemon juice until everything is smoothly combined and beautifully sweet.
  • In another cold bowl, whip the heavy cream until lovely soft peaks form. Be careful not to over-whip!
  • If you're using gelatin for a firmer cheesecake, bloom and gently melt it according to package directions, then stir it into the cream cheese mixture.
  • Carefully f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ture until it's just combined and beautifully airy.
  • Pour this luscious filling over your chilled crust, spreading it evenly and smoothing the top for a professional finish.
  • Place your cheesecake back in the refrigerator to chill for at least 4 hours, or ideally, overnight, for the perfect set.
  • For the best texture and flavor, let your cheesecake sit at room temperature for about 12 minutes before slicing and serving. Enjoy!

Nutrition Information (per serving):
  • Calories: 265
  • Total Carbs: 4g
  • Net Carbs: 3g
  • Fats: 26g
  • Protein: 5g
